Explain the role of schemas and mental models in cognitive psychology, and how they influence perception and memory?
Schemas and mental models are cognitive frameworks that help individuals organize and interpret information, influencing perception and memory. Schemas are predefined mental structures that represent a person’s knowledge about a concept or event, guiding how we perceive, interpret, and recall information. Mental models are dynamic cognitive representations used to understand complex systems or processes. Both play crucial roles in shaping cognition by influencing how we perceive, process, store, and retrieve information.

Schemas: Schemas are cognitive frameworks that help individuals organize and interpret information based on their prior knowledge and experiences. They influence how we perceive, interpret, and remember new information by providing a mental blueprint for understanding the world.
-
Mental Models: Mental models are cognitive representations of how things work in the real world. They help individuals make sense of complex situations by simplifying reality into manageable structures. Mental models guide decision-making and problem-solving by allowing us to predict outcomes based on our understanding of causal relationships.
-
Example of Schemas: A schema for a restaurant might include expectations about the menu, atmosphere, and service. If a person visits a new restaurant that aligns with their schema (e.g., cozy ambiance, friendly staff), they are more likely to have a positive perception and remember the experience accurately.
-
Example of Mental Models: In physics, mental models like Newton’s laws of motion help us understand and predict the behavior of objects in motion. By applying these principles to real-world situations (e.g., predicting the trajectory of a moving object), we demonstrate the use of mental models to interpret and navigate our environment.

Benefits: Schemas and mental models streamline cognitive processes, enhance learning efficiency, aid in problem-solving, and facilitate memory retrieval. By organizing information into coherent structures, they help individuals make sense of complex stimuli in the environment.
-
Challenges: Overreliance on schemas can lead to cognitive biases or stereotypes that distort perceptions. Similarly, rigid mental models may hinder adaptability in changing environments or prevent individuals from considering alternative perspectives.
